A 12th-century sculpture previously identified as Saraswati has been correctly identified as Gayatri. Digital documentation and 3D mapping revealed iconographic clues missed for centuries. The absence of a veena, a common Saraswati attribute, proved crucial in this re-identification. This rare image of Gayatri, embodying Vedic wisdom, was unearthed in Dhar. The rediscovered icon now represents Madhya Pradesh’s digital heritage mission.
